3: # This file contains a list of branches that exist in the NetBSD CVS
4: # tree and their current state.
5: #
6: # This list is necessarily incomplete.
7: #
8: # Within reason, developers may create branch and version tags at any
9: # time for any purpose. To avoid name collisions, private tags should
10: # have names which begin with the developer's NetBSD login name
11: # followed by a - or _ character (e.g., thorpej_scsipi,
12: # thorpej-signal)
13: #
14: # Any branch or version tag not listed here should be assumed to be
15: # private to the developer who created it. It is inappropriate for
16: # anyone other than that developer to commit, move tags, or otherwise
17: # modify the contents of the branch.
18: #
19: # Please update this file when a new branch is ready for consumption
20: # by folks other than the maintainer, or when the use or status of an
21: # existing branch changes significantly.
22: #
23: # Format:
24: # Branch: name of branch
25: # Description: Purpose and intention of the branch
26: # Status: Active/Terminated/Dormant
27: # Start Date: date first instantiated
28: # End Date: date it was Terminated/made_Dormant, if any
29: # Base Tag: netbsd-1-5-base, etc.
30: # Maintainer: Somebody to blame.
31: # Scope: Portion of the tree covered.
32: # Notes: Various other info, perhaps explanation of special tags,
33: # who-may-commit policies, etc.

388: Branch: nathanw_sa
389: Description: Scheduler activations
390: Status: Active
391: Start Date: 5 March 2001
1.9 thorpej 392: End Date: 18 January 2003
1.1 lukem 393: Base Tag: nathanw_sa_base
1.10 salo 394: Maintainer: Nathan Williams <nathanw@NetBSD.org>
1.1 lukem 395: Scope: kernel, libc, libkvm, libpthread, libpthread_dbg, include,
396: bin/ps usr.bin/systat usr.bin/top usr.bin/w
397: gnu/dist/toolchain/gdb gnu/usr.bin/gdb
398:
399: Notes: The idea of scheduler activations is described in the
400: classic paper by Anderson et al., in ACM Transactions
401: a on Computer Systems volume 10 issue 1 (1992),which
402: can be found at
403: http://www.acm.org/pubs/citations/journals/tocs/1992-10-1/p53-anderson/
404: Many ideas in the implementation are based on the
405: implementation of scheduler activations added to Mach
406: 3.0 and described by Davis et al. in the University of
407: Washington CS tech report 92-08-93, which can be found
408: at
409: ftp://ftp.cs.washington.edu/tr/1992/08/UW-CSE-92-08-03.PS.Z
410:
411: My USENIX paper on the subject can be found at
412: http://web.mit.edu/nathanw/www/usenix/
413:
414: Please consult with the maintainer before committing
415: to this branch.
416: Other tags starting with nathanw_sa reserved for
417: branch management and are not guaranteed to be stable.
1.9 thorpej 418:
419: Trunk tagged with "nathanw_sa_before_merge" prior to
420: merging branch down to trunk. Branch tagged with
421: "nathanw_sa_end" to indicate the ending revision of
422: the branch.

424: Branch: newlock
425: Description: New locking primitives, based on Solaris's
426: Status: Active
427: Start Date: March 9, 2002
428: End Date:
429: Base Tag: newlock-base
1.10 salo 430: Maintainer: Jason R. Thorpe <thorpej@NetBSD.org>
1.1 lukem 431: Scope: Kernel
432:
433: Notes: The goal is to replace the existing lockmgr() and
434: simple_lock() based locking mechanisms with the
435: primitives found in Solaris: mutexes and rwlocks.

620: Branch: wrstuden-devbsize
621: Description: Modify buffer cache to deal with different devices having
622: different block sizes. Also DEV_BSIZE would go away.
623: Status: Terminated
624: Start Date: Aug or Sept 1999
625: End Date: 1 Apr 2000
626: Base tag: wrstuden-devbsize-base
1.10 salo 627: Maintainer: Bill Studenmund <wrstuden@NetBSD.org>
1.1 lukem 628: Scope: kernel
629: Notes: No longer active due to lack of time, and introduction
630: of UBC. In terms of UBC, the primary cache for
631: file data is the VM cache, which needs to operate
632: in terms of VM pages. As no existing device has native
633: pages the same size as our VM pages, there already is
634: a mapping going on between the VM system and the
635: underlying blocks. So it would be easier and cleaner
636: to adjust that to deal w/ different block sizes.
637: Also with UBC, all i/o is in terms of bytes at an offset
638: with a certain length, so the exact block size isn't a big
639: deal.
640:
641: Any other wrstuden-devbsize tag may (and should) go away.
